Is there a method to delete all "In Model" materials at once, without clicking on every material? My model is empty anyway.
This is because I want to create several new material colletions. The way I know how to do it (import textures into SU and explode and "Save collection as...") requires cleaning "In Model" every time - otherwise each collection will contain materials from earlier collections. So before starting clicking hundreds of times to delete one by one, I want to make sure there is no other way.
-
You can use, for example, the Remove all materials plugin and then do "purge unused" materials.
